Donald Trump has publicly backed a Republican plan to redraw the state's congressional map to dilute Democratic influence by splitting Indianapolis into parts grafted into four Republican-leaning districts.The House approved the map and the Senate is set to take up the measure while lawmakers report threats, intimidation and targeted harassment tied to the dispute.Several senators and other Republicans, including
Mike Braun,
JD Vance and
Mitch Daniels, have taken different positions as outside groups such as
Turning Point Action and
Turning Point USA threaten primaries and mobilize supporters.
